What is ADHD?
ADHD Testing is identified by relentless patterns of in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ity that can interfere with day-to-day operating or development. While generally seen as a pediatric condition, research study now reveals that lots of people continue to experience symptoms in adulthood. Symptoms can manifest in numerous ways, including difficulties with focus, organization, time management, and preserving relationships.
Symptoms of ADHD in Adults
Comprehending the symptoms of ADHD in adults is essential for correct recognition and management. Here are some common signs:

Can adults be diagnosed with ADHD?
Yes, adults can be identified with ADHD. Symptoms often persist from childhood, but many adults may not recognize they have the condition till later on in life.
2. Are online ADHD tests precise?
While online tests can provide insights into symptoms, they are not conclusive. Accuracy may differ, and these tests must not replace professional evaluation.

4. What are common treatments for adult ADHD?
Typical treatments for adult ADHD may include behavior modification, medication (such as stimulants or non-stimulants), and lifestyle modifications such as workout and mindfulness practices.
5. Can ADHD be handled without medication?
Yes, numerous people handle their ADHD symptoms with behavioral treatments, way of life modifications, and assistance groups. Medication is efficient for some, however is not the only solution.
